My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Mud is a happy, active boy who’s ready to find a family that can keep up with his fun-loving spirit. He is house broken and has great manners in the home, making him a solid and dependable companion. Mud is dog friendly and kid friendly, making him a wonderful option for an active household. He enjoys being around others and thrives on interaction and play. He’s definitely on the more energetic side and loves staying busy. Walks, runs, and exploring new places are some of his favorite things. If you’re looking for a partner for outdoor adventures or daily exercise, Mud is your guy. The good news is he has nice leash manners, so outings are enjoyable and manageable. Mud is not food aggressive and does well during mealtime. And while he may have plenty of energy outside, he’s also a big cuddle bug at heart. After he’s had his exercise, he’s more than happy to settle down and soak up affection. Mud would do best in a home that embraces his active lifestyle and gives him both the physical activity and the love he craves. In return, you’ll get a loyal, playful, and snuggly best friend

More about this shelter

The Washington County SPCA is an open access shelter whose mission is to protect the welfare of the animals we come in contact with, and to promote the humane treatment and well being of these animals. We serve the animals, citizens, and communities of Washington County from our location at 16620 State Highway 123, just north of Bartlesville, Oklahoma.
